1604.14.30
Other
This code covers prepared or preserved tuna and skipjack, specifically those that are whole or in pieces, not minced, in airtight containers, and not packed in oil. Use this code when importing this type of fish to determine the applicable 12.50% general duty rate (or free rate for eligible countries) as defined within Chapter 16 of the Harmonized Tariff Schedule.

Detailed information for HTS Code 1604.14.30
This code falls within the section of the Harmonized Tariff Schedule covering prepared foodstuffs, specifically preparations of fish. Code 1604.14.30 covers prepared or preserved tunas, skipjack, and bonito, presented whole or in pieces but not minced, and in airtight containers not packed in oil. This particular code further specifies “other” preparations within that category, meaning it covers tuna and skipjack not otherwise specified, and has several statistical suffixes to indicate the type of container and specific fish species (albacore) and container size. When selecting a statistical suffix, consider whether the preparation is albacore tuna, the type of container used (foil or other flexible container versus other), and whether the container weighs 6.8 kg or less.

The general duty rate for HTS code 1604.14.30 is 12.50%, applying to imports from countries without a specified preferential trade agreement. However, several countries—including A+, AU, BH, CL, CO, D, IL, JO, KR, MA, OM, P, PA, PE, R, S, and SG—qualify for a 0% duty rate under special trade agreements or preference programs. This preferential rate applies to all subdivisions (1604.14.30.51, 1604.14.30.59, 1604.14.30.91, and 1604.14.30.99) contingent on meeting the rules of origin for those agreements. All imports are reported in kilograms (kg).
Rate of Duty (Column 2): 25%

Code subdivisions
1604.14.30.51
Prepared or preserved fish; caviar and caviar substitutes prepared from fish eggs: > Fish, whole or in pieces, but not minced: > Tunas, skipjack tuna and bonito (Sarda spp.): > Tunas and skipjack: > In airtight containers: > Not in oil: > Other > Albacore (Thunnus alalunga): > In foil or other flexible con- tainers weighing with their contents not more than 6.8 kg each
1604.14.30.59
Prepared or preserved fish; caviar and caviar substitutes prepared from fish eggs: > Fish, whole or in pieces, but not minced: > Tunas, skipjack tuna and bonito (Sarda spp.): > Tunas and skipjack: > In airtight containers: > Not in oil: > Other > Albacore (Thunnus alalunga): > Other
1604.14.30.91
Prepared or preserved fish; caviar and caviar substitutes prepared from fish eggs: > Fish, whole or in pieces, but not minced: > Tunas, skipjack tuna and bonito (Sarda spp.): > Tunas and skipjack: > In airtight containers: > Not in oil: > Other > Other: > In foil or other flexible con- tainers weighing with their contents not more than 6.8 kg each
1604.14.30.99
Prepared or preserved fish; caviar and caviar substitutes prepared from fish eggs: > Fish, whole or in pieces, but not minced: > Tunas, skipjack tuna and bonito (Sarda spp.): > Tunas and skipjack: > In airtight containers: > Not in oil: > Other > Other: > Other
